🇫🇷 Le Conditionnel Passé – Brief Tutorial The conditionnel passé is used to talk about an action that would have happened in the past under certain conditions. It is commonly used to express regret, criticism, missed opportunities, hypothetical past situations, and reported information. 1. Le Plus-que-parfait en français | The French Pluperfect The plus-que-parfait is an essential French past tense used to describe an action that had already happened before another past action.
